What is Overclocking?

Overclocking is the process of increasing the clock speed of a computer’s hardware components, such as the processor, graphics card, and memory, to achieve higher performance and faster speeds. This is achieved by manipulating the system’s clock rate, which is the rate at which the CPU, GPU, and RAM process and execute instructions. By increasing the clock speed, users can enjoy improved performance, enhanced gaming experiences, and faster performance in multitasking scenarios.

Risks and Considerations

While overclocking can offer numerous benefits, it’s essential to be aware of the risks and considerations:

  • Heat Generation: Overclocking can lead to increased heat generation, which can damage your hardware if not properly cooled.
  • Stability and Reliability: Overclocking can also lead to system instability and crashes if not done correctly.
  • Voiding Warranties: Overclocking can void your warranty, so be sure to check your manufacturer’s policies before attempting to overclock.

Best Practices for Overclocking

To successfully overclock your system, follow these best practices:

  1. Monitor Temperatures: Keep an eye on your system temperatures to avoid overheating.
  2. Use Stable Software: Use reliable and stable software to overclock your system, such as CPU-Z, GPU-Z, and Prime95.
  3. Gradual Overclocking: Gradually increase the clock speed to avoid system crashes and instability.
  4. Monitor Performance: Monitor your system performance and adjust the clock speed accordingly.
  5. Test and Verify: Test and verify the stability and performance of your system after overclocking.
